How to Style Neutral Colours: Summer Lookbook
As summer rolls in, so does the excitement of refreshing our wardrobes with breezy, versatile outfits. While bold colours often steal the spotlight in summer, neutral tones provide a trendy, timeless foundation for a myriad of looks. In this article, we’ll explore some chic ways to style neutral colours for a stunning summer lookbook.
Why Choose Neutrals?
- Versatility: Neutrals can easily be mixed and matched, making it easy to create various outfits without cluttering your closet.
- Timeless Appeal: Neutral colours never go out of style, providing a classic aesthetic that remains relevant season after season.
- Focus on Accessories: Styling with neutrals allows you to play with accessories. Bold bags, statement jewelry, and vibrant shoes can shine against a muted outfit.
Key Neutral Colors
- Beige and Tan: Warm and inviting, perfect for beach outings or casual brunches.
- White and Off-White: Fresh and clean, ideal for creating a crisp summer look.
- Greys: Versatile and chic, adding depth without overwhelming the outfit.
- Blacks and Charcoals: Great for evening looks and unexpected summer vibes.
Outfit Ideas for Your Summer Lookbook
1. Casual Day Out
- Outfit: Beige linen shorts, a white cotton tee, and tan sandals.
- Accessories: A straw hat, minimalist gold jewelry, and a woven tote.
- Look: This outfit combines comfort and style, perfect for a day of exploring local markets or enjoying a picnic in the park. Linen is breathable, keeping you cool, while the neutral palette allows for a laid-back yet polished appearance.
2. Effortless Chic
- Outfit: Soft grey slip dress paired with white lace-up sneakers.
- Accessories: A light denim jacket, oversized sunglasses, and a simple crossbody bag.
- Look: Ideal for a girl’s day out or lunch with friends, this ensemble seamlessly transitions from day to night. The dress offers elegance, while the sneakers keep it grounded and comfortable.
3. Beach Vibes
- Outfit: White high-waisted bikini paired with a sheer beige cover-up.
- Accessories: Wide-brimmed straw hat, oversized sunglasses, and a neutral-toned beach bag.
- Look: A classic summer combo, this look embodies sophistication and ease. The light colours reflect the summer sun and keep you feeling cool by the shore.
4. Feminine Flair
- Outfit: Off-white midi skirt paired with a fitted tan bodysuit.
- Accessories: Strappy sandals, a delicate layered necklace, and a dainty clutch.
- Look: This outfit is perfect for a summer wedding or outdoor event. The tonal layering creates an elegant effect, while the breathable fabrics offer comfort and style.
5. Evening Glam
- Outfit: Charcoal jumpsuit with a fitted silhouette complemented by black heeled mules.
- Accessories: Statement earrings, a bold red lip, and a sleek clutch.
- Look: Elevate your evening wear with this chic jumpsuit. The neutral base allows you to play with accessories, making it easy to adapt for any night out.
Tips for Styling Neutrals
- Layering: Layering different shades of neutrals adds depth to your outfits. Consider combining textures like linen, cotton, and silk for visual interest.
- Statement Accessories: Use accessories to add pops of colour or texture to your neutral looks. This can be a bright handbag, patterned scarf, or unique footwear.
- Mixing Textures: Mixing different textures can turn a simple neutral outfit into a stylish ensemble. Pair a knitted top with sleek trousers, or a silk blouse with linen shorts.
- Balance: Aim for balance in your outfit. If you choose a flowy top, pair it with structured bottoms to create a harmonious silhouette.
